Dark Kadabra: A Piece of Pokémon History
Dark Kadabra is one of the most sought-after Pokémon cards in the world. Not only is it a beautiful and powerful card, but it is also one of the few Kadabra cards ever printed before a 20-year absence due to a lawsuit.
The lawsuit was filed by Uri Geller, a famous magician who claimed that Kadabra's name and design were based on him. Geller eventually dropped the lawsuit in 2020, but the damage had already been done. No new Kadabra cards were printed for over 20 years.
This makes Dark Kadabra even more special. It is a reminder of a time when Kadabra was still a popular Pokémon. It is also a piece of Pokémon history, and a reminder of a time when the Pokémon Trading Card Game was just getting started.
